Explain whatever you know about the story The monkeys paw ?

There are three wishes made with the paw while there are also consequence for the wish.

The first wish, is when the Whites did not really believe in the paw, and thought it was a joke, so Mr. White wished 200 pounds. They did got the money afterwards, but their son, Herbert, got mangled in some machine and died, and so they received 200 pounds as a compensation.

The second wish is Mrs. Whites wants Herbert to live again. We should assume that he did got "alive" since in the story someone was knocking fiercely after the wish. However, we need to remember, Herbert died from machine mangling, which means his whole body is basically break in corpse. So the compensation is Herbert's corpse got "alive".

The third wish is Mr.White wished Herbert dead. However, this is not told in the story but it is foreshadowed because after his wish, the knocking goes away.
